By A Staff Reporter,Bhaktapur, May 2: An interaction was held on Misa Pasa, an anthology of short stories in Nepal Bhasa by the Chancellor of Nepal Bhasa Academy, Yagyaratna Dhakhwa, in Bhaktapur recently.
At the programme organised by Sirjana Abhiyan, the speakers spoke about the new topics, tendencies and the impact of the short stories in Nepal Bhasa.
Renowned short story writer Dhruba Madhikarmi said that Dhakhwa has impressively written the topics including the effect of COVID-19 and conflict between two different cultures, inquisitiveness about a new person and the happiness of the Dashain festival, in a very easy language.
Critic Prem Heera Tuladhar found the short stories on social issues by Dhakhwa were impressively realistic.
Other speakers, including journalist Jeetendra Rasik, Harigovinda Bhomi, Padmaa Khayargoli also highlighted the characteristics of the book.
Published by Nepal Bhasa Academy, the book consists of 35 short stories on miscellaneous topics.
